SpaceX slides as AI spending worries overshadow early returns
SpaceX reported strong initial results from its artificial intelligence investments during its first public earnings call. However, investors expressed apprehension regarding the sustainability of these AI expenditures, questioning how long Starlink's profits can support ongoing development.
